China Launches Space Computing Satellite Constellation

Abu Dhabi: China launched a Long March-2D carrier rocket on Wednesday, placing a space computing satellite constellation into space. The rocket was launched from the Jiuquan Satellite Launch Centre in Northwest China.

According to Emirates News Agency, this mission marks the 576th flight of the Long March series carrier rockets. This series has been a crucial part of China's space exploration efforts, and the successful deployment of the satellite constellation represents another milestone in China's expanding capabilities in space computing and satellite technology.
